    I can't understand a word Su is singing...... so how can she bring tears to my eyes? I think the language barrier has been a blessing for her as it caused to Su to learn how to communicate emotion, translating the song lyrics, by inflection and tone instead of language. She may never have Aretha Franklin four octave range or perform the vocal gymnastics of Christina Aguilera, but neither of these performers have ever brought tears to my eyes. It's the qualities of Su's voice that makes her special, not necessarily its quality, and much of that comes from trying to get people who do not understand her language to understand the emotion of the song.

    @safrisaleh412 Před 3 lety +13

    The acoustic guitar which Moametal plays, belong to the late Mikio Fujioka the guitarist who passed away on the 5th January 2018.
